Who I Am
Hi, I’m Kayla Hernandez, a certified birth doula, postpartum doula, and childbirth educator based in the St. Croix River Valley area. I have 3 years of experience and have served 80+ families. I’ve dedicated my career to helping families feel seen, supported, and confident as they navigate one of life’s most transformative journeys.
I’m a wife, and mother of 4. Our family story stretches across cultures, histories, and generations. We come from many places and that diversity shapes the way I see, serve, and support other families. With roots stemming from Mexico, Honduras, Sweden, and Alabama.
We prioritize our faith in God, love and an emphasis on holistic health in our household. With my experience as a nursing assistant and a background in health information management, I combine professional knowledge with compassionate, personalized care. Every family I support is unique — your birth goals, values, and vision guide the support I provide.
When I am not doula-ing you can find me spending time outdoors, exploring new places with my family, learning a new skill, reading, writing and practicing photography and crocheting.
What I Believe
I believe that birth is sacred, that families thrive when they are informed and empowered, and that every parent deserves steady, compassionate guidance. My approach is not one-size-fits-all — I meet each family where they are, tailoring support to your needs, preferences, and birth plan.
Whether you’re wanting a hospital, birth center, or home birth, with or without pain medication, my goal is to help you feel calm, prepared, and confident every step of the way.

Why Families Choose My Love Grows
My work is deeply rooted in faith. I believe God designed birth with intention and strength. I approach families with respect, prayerful support, and reverence for this sacred season. I view pregnancy and birth as a natural physiological process. For most low-risk individuals this means labor and birth can progress in a safe and healthy way with the right adequate support.
Unfortunately, many medical and social systems do not provide the support birthing families truly need. I strive to prioritize preparation, education, and unity over panic or pressure. Strong foundations create better experiences emotionally, physically, and spiritually. I believe every parent is capable of making their own informed decisions that align with their values, faith and needs. As your Doula I am here to honor and empower those decisions.
I hold space and recognize families who require or choose medical interventions, experience complications or face loss. Every journey into parenthood requires courage, resilience and love. Every story deserves to be honored and celebrated.
